Minor body work is cosmetic damage that involves both the panel and the paint, which puts it past pure PDR but well short of collision repair. Think of a dent where the impact cracked or chipped the paint, a bumper cover that is scraped and split at the corner, curb rash along a bumper lip or lower panel, a scuffed and dented fender edge from a parking garage pillar. The panels are all still the right shape underneath, they just need metal or plastic corrected and the finish rebuilt.
These jobs need two skills in one visit. First the substrate is corrected, metal dents are worked back to shape and plastic damage is leveled with flexible filler made for bumper covers. Then the finish is rebuilt, feather sanding, primer, basecoat mixed to your factory color code, clear coat, and a blend into the surrounding panel. Because both halves happen at your curb in a single appointment, you skip the teardown, the rental car, and the body shop markup that comes with them.
The dent comes first. Wherever the metal allows, it is massaged back with PDR technique so little or no filler is needed, which keeps the repair thin, stable, and invisible under paint. Any remaining low spots get a skim of filler sanded level with the panel. On plastic bumpers the process adapts, cracks are ground out, bonded, and reinforced with flexible materials, then leveled, because a bumper cover flexes and a rigid repair would simply crack again on the first parking nudge.
Then the finish is rebuilt layer by layer over the corrected area. Adhesion promoter goes on any bare plastic, primer seals the repair, basecoat restores your color, and clear coat restores gloss and UV protection. The clear is blended past the repair zone so there is no hard line where new paint meets old. It is the same sequence a good shop follows, minus the building, and most jobs are finished the same day they start, often in about an hour or two.
Some damage is honestly beyond mobile scope, and pretending otherwise would waste your money. If an impact bent the structure behind the panel, pushed a bumper reinforcement bar or crash absorber out of place, broke headlight or sensor mounts, or left doors and panels visibly out of alignment, that is collision repair. It needs measuring equipment, teardown, and sometimes insurance involvement, and a body shop is the right tool for that job. We will never talk you into a cosmetic fix over structural damage.
The dividing line is simple. If the damage is skin deep, panel shape and paint, we repair it at your curb for a fraction of a shop quote. If it goes deeper than the skin, we say so as soon as we see your photos, before you have spent a dollar or an afternoon. Minor body work pricing follows the combination in front of us. A dent that needs reshaping plus a refinish runs $495 to $700+, a full fender, door, or quarter panel refinish runs $650 to $750+, and hatch or liftgate work runs $525 to $850+ depending on how much of the panel gets refinished. Downtown San Diego is a vertical parking economy. Most residents and workers live with assigned stalls in multi story garages, and those garages were striped for smaller cars than the ones we drive now. Concrete pillars sit tight against stall lines, ramps turn sharp, and one moment of misjudgment leaves a white scuff down a bumper corner or a crease along a quarter panel. Add the Gaslamp Quarter and East Village street grid, where parallel parking is combat sport on event nights, and it is no mystery why downtown cars carry more bumper rash per mile than anywhere else in the county.
Petco Park makes it worse in a very specific way. On game and concert nights, thousands of cars funnel into East Village lots and garages at once, drivers circle for scarce street spots, and bumpers get used as parking sensors. Little Italy brings its own version, with dense dinner traffic and tight curb spaces along India Street. Then there is the freeway funnel itself, where I-5, SR-163 and SR-94 all pour into the same few blocks, and stop and go merging produces the low speed tap that cracks a bumper cover without ever feeling like an accident.
